Frontier played in-conference for the first time on Monday and got just the result they were looking for. They walked away with a 5-2 win over the Shadyside Tigers. This was payback for the Cougars, who suffered a 4-1 loss the last time these two teams met.
Aidan Wolfe spent all seven innings on the mound, and it's clear why: he surrendered just two earned runs on ten hits.
At the plate, Brayden Powers was excellent, going 1-for-3 with two RBI and one double. That double was his first of the season. Luke Mendenhall was another key player, going 1-for-2 with two runs and one stolen base.
Frontier's victory bumped their record up to 6-9. As for Shadyside, their defeat dropped their record down to 9-9.
Both teams are looking forward to the support of their home crowds in their upcoming games. Frontier will square off against Waterford at 5:00 p.m. on Tuesday. As for Shadyside, they will look to defend their home field on Wednesday against Union Local at 5:00 p.m.
